Published Spoilers

  • 7/25 -- Heroes Pictures posts six images reportedly from Four Months Later, including the two images below.
  • 7/20 -- Jack Coleman told SCI FI Wire, "It makes it very clear, in the very first episode of this year, [Mr. Bennet] is not defanged." He added that the Bennet family is reunited and has relocated, "and it's a new world."
  • 6/22 -- Kristin Veitch says that the first episode is "very Claire-centric".
  • 6/21 -- IGN announces the title of the episode. As explained in the title, the episode will take place four months after the events of How to Stop an Exploding Man (with the obvious exception of Hiro's story since he went back in time to 1671). Other highlights:
    • Hiro's storyline will pick up at the exact moment that he was last seen in How to Stop an Exploding Man.
    • George Takei will return in this episode, reprising his role as Kaito Nakamura.
  • 6/14 -- SpoilerFix reports that Four Months Later "will feature a villainous Japanese warlord who is known as "White Beard," various old Japanese villagers as well as Tuko, a West-African man working for Irish mobster Ricky.
  • 6/12 -- Kristin claims that Blackie is also known as Will.
  • 6/4 -- Princess Keriyama will debut in this episode, according to Kristin Veitch.
  • 5/26 -- TV Squad reports that some of the characters that will premiere in this episode include Maya, Kane, Princess Keriyama, April, West, May (who is probably Debbie), Georgie, Blackie, Ricky, Bob, and Kincaid (who is probably Detective Fuller).
